To prepare your notebook for shipment

See "To receive repair service" on the previous page to determine if your notebook must
be sent in for service. If it must, prepare it for shipment as follows.
If you have questions about packaging requirements when returning your notebook for
repair, contact HP Service and Support—see page 54. If your notebook is not packaged
properly, you will be responsible for any damages that occur to it during shipping.
1. Important. back up your hard disk drive. The hard disk may need to be replaced or
reformatted while your notebook is being repaired.
2. Hewlett-Packard cannot guarantee the return of removable components. Please
remove the following before you send your notebook for service:
• PC cards.
• AC adapter and power cord.
• Any removable media, such as CDs, DVDs, or floppy disks.
• Any hardware not involved in the problem and not requested for repair.
3. When sending your notebook to Hewlett-Packard, please use the original product
packaging or other substantial packaging to avoid damage to the notebook in transit.
Make sure at least three inches of suitable packaging material surround the notebook.
Your notebook will be returned to you in new packaging.
If the hard disk drive is defective, you will receive a replacement drive that is either
unformatted or loaded with software for verification. You should restore the notebook's
original software using your Recovery CDs (see "To recover the factory installation of
your hard disk" on page 50) or other recovery method.
